Amine Guard™
Removes CO2 and H2S from gas streams using solvent absorption
Amine Guard™ is a process technology developed by Honeywell UOP for acid gas removal applications. It combines high-performance solvents called UCARSOL with UOP's engineering expertise to remove contaminants like CO2 and H2S from high-volume gas streams. The process is applicable to natural gas, syngas, gasification, blast furnace gases, and other sources.
In the Amine Guard process, acid or flue gases are scrubbed in an absorber column using UCARSOL solvent. The rich solvent then flows from the bottom of the absorber through a heat exchange process and is regenerated in a stripping tower. The lean solvent is then recirculated back to the absorber for further CO2 absorption. In addition to CO2 and H2S, the process can also remove COS and other sulfur components.
Key benefits of Amine Guard include optimized regeneration energy requirements, minimal hydrocarbon/H2/CO losses, and the ability to utilize waste heat for stripping steam. Two-stage configurations and process optimizations like flash-only solvent regeneration can be implemented for improved energy efficiency.
The technology is considered to be at Technology Readiness Level 9, having been in commercial operation since the 1990s with over 400 units installed worldwide. Honeywell UOP provides expertise and support across the entire project lifecycle, from feasibility studies through to operational services. The process is applicable to industries like biomass/coal gasification, natural gas processing, ammonia/hydrogen production, and synthetic natural gas manufacturing.
